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Brown Tent-making Bat | truncate donax |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Mollusca (Mollusks)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Bivalvia (Bivalvia)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Cardiida (Cardiida)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Donacidae |
| Genus | Uroderma | Donax |
| Species | Uroderma magnirostrum | Donax trunculus |
